Appropriate Preposition:

  • Zealous for ( আগ্রহী ) He is zealous for improvement.
  • Informed of ( অবহিত ) I was not informed of your misfortune.
  • Overcome by ( দমন করা ) He was overcome by anger.
  • Weak in ( কাঁচা ) He is weak in Mathematics.
  • Lack of ( অভাব ) I have no lack of friends.
  • Take after ( সদৃশ হওয়া ) The boy takes after his father.

Idioms:

  • Bring to book ( শাস্তি দেওয়া ) He should be brought to book for his misconduct.
  • Bad blood ( মনোমালিন্য ; শত্রতা ; দ্বেষ ) Now there is bad blood between the two brothers.
  • Big gun ( নেতৃস্থানীয় ব্যক্তি ) He is a big gun of our locality.
  • Man of letters ( পন্ডিত লোক ) Sir Ashutosh Mukherjee was a man of letters.
  • Kith and kin ( নিকট আত্মীয় ) He has no good relationship with his kith and kin.
  • Cock and bull story ( গাঁজাখুরি গল্প ) Nobody will believe your cock and bull story
